Recommendations to the HUC

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

EDUCATION:

* Establish a student review board within each department to help in deciding tenure for professors. (Passed by the HUC.)

* House election of HPC members. (Passed.)

SOCIAL:

* Students should not participate on any "committees"--of the student-faculty-administration variety--until they have been assured concrete power in these decisions in which they are being asked to "participate." Participation must be equal and responsible. (Passed.)

* Regarding such concrete power, students should not accept minority status on any group which makes the "social" decisions at Harvard College. (Passed.)

* HUC members should be elected by popular election in every House, not chosen by the House Committees.

* House Masters should be nominated by a committee composed two-thirds of students and one third of the Senior Common Room in every House; Masters' terms should be subject to committee review after a specific period of time. (Passed.)

* Student selection of House faculty.

* Abolish the Committee on Houses and decentralize all social decisions to House level; create in its place a Committee for Small Problems with Master and an elected student from each House.

FINANCIAL:

* A minimum of one-half of the Board of Overseers should be composed of students and faculty and both students and faculty should be allowed to vote for all Overseers members.

* Three out of five members of the Corporation should be students or faculty members serving four-year non-continuous terms and elected by Overseers or by student-faculty-alumni.

* The President of the University should be elected by students and faculty to serve a four-year renewable term.
